Main Body Material: PP

PP, also known as polypropylene, is used as the main body material for this Tornado air knife category. It offers a useful balance of chemical resistance, low density, moisture resistance and cost efficiency, especially for wet process equipment and general industrial blow-off applications.

PP is not positioned as a high-temperature or heavy-impact metal replacement. If the process involves high air temperature, high ambient temperature, strong mechanical load, severe impact, special hygiene requirements or extremely corrosive chemicals, stainless steel, titanium alloy or other materials may be recommended according to the actual operating conditions.

· PP provides good resistance in many water-based, mildly acidic and alkaline process environments.

· The lightweight body helps reduce installation load and makes machine adjustment easier.

· PP is suitable for wet blow-off, rinse-line support and chemical-resistant equipment areas under normal temperature conditions.

· Chemical compatibility should be confirmed according to the chemical type, concentration, temperature and exposure time.

Application Cases

Bottle and Can Drying

Tornado air knives can be installed after washing or rinsing to remove water from bottles, cans and similar containers. Focused airflow helps reduce residual droplets before labeling, coding, packaging or inspection.

Tube, Pipe and Cable Lines

For round or narrow products such as tubes, pipes, cables and profiles, a Tornado air knife can provide targeted blow-off at the required position. It helps remove surface water and residue as the product moves through the production line.

Parts Cleaning and Water Removal

In parts washing or cleaning equipment, Tornado air knives can help blow off water, cleaning solution or small particles from machined parts, plastic components and other irregular surfaces before drying, assembly or packaging.

Packaging and Conveyor Blow-Off

Tornado air knives can be used on packaging lines and conveyors where products need localized drying, dust removal or surface cleaning. Their compact PP body makes them suitable for flexible installation in automated equipment.

How to Select a Tornado Air Knife

To select the right Tornado air knife, QXY recommends confirming the following information before quotation and design:

1. Product shape, size and the exact area that needs blow-off.

2. Product width or diameter, conveyor speed and production rhythm.

3. Drying, cleaning, dust removal or residue blow-off target.

4. Available air source, pressure, airflow and pipe size.

5. Working distance between the air outlet and product surface.

6. Installation space, mounting direction and preferred air inlet position.

7. Chemical environment, ambient temperature and air temperature.

8. Photos, drawings or layout information of the machine location.

Can PP Tornado air knives be used in high-temperature areas?

PP is not recommended as the first choice for high-temperature air or high-temperature ambient conditions. If the process involves elevated temperature, stainless steel or titanium alloy may be more suitable. Please confirm the actual air temperature, ambient temperature and working distance before selection.

How is a Tornado air knife different from a standard linear air knife?

A standard linear air knife is usually selected for wide, flat surface coverage. A Tornado air knife is selected when the application needs more focused airflow, compact installation or blow-off around special product shapes and selected surface areas.
